VP of Accounting Responsibilities:

  • Lead and oversee the month‑end, quarter‑end, and year‑end close process across the holding company and all operating entities.
  • Ensure accurate, timely preparation of consolidated financial statements in accordance with U.S. GAAP.
  • Maintain the chart of accounts, accounting policies, and reporting frameworks to support scale and standardization across the portfolio.
  • Oversee consolidation of multi‑entity, multi‑location financials, including intercompany eliminations and consolidation entries.
  • Prepare Board, lender, and investor reporting packages with high quality, accuracy, and insight.
  • Partner directly with the private equity sponsor on reporting requirements, debt compliance, KPI dashboards, and financial transparency.
  • Ensure timely completion of covenant calculations, borrowing base certificates, and other lender deliverables.
  • Support PE value‑creation initiatives, including margin expansion, working capital optimization, and EBITDA improvements.
  • Provide financial leadership during strategic planning processes in coordination with the CFO.

VP of Accounting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ance required; CPA strongly preferred.
  • 10-15+ years of progressive accounting leadership experience.
  • Experience in a private‑equity‑backed, roll‑up, or multi‑entity environment strongly preferred.
  • Deep knowledge of U.S. GAAP and financial reporting standards.
  • Woring or been around multiple Mergers & Aquistions (10+)
  • Hands‑on experience with acquisition integration, purchase accounting, and technical accounting matters.
  • Proven experience leading a high‑performance accounting team in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Strong systems experience (ERP implementation, consolidation tools, automation tools).
  • Excellent communication skills - able to convey complex accounting topics to executives, PE sponsors, and non‑finance stakeholders.
  • Ability to operate with urgency, drive results, and thrive in a high‑growth, evolving environment.
